Does the Kia Sorento come with a 6 cylinder engine?
The 2020 Kia Sorento had a beefy V6 engine option and could tow up to 5,000 lb. That is very impressive for its price range. Now the V6 engine has been dropped for the 2021 model. Instead, the 2021 Kia Sorento has a 2.5-liter inline-4 base engine with 191 hp and 182 lb-ft of torque.

What kind of engine does a Kia Sorento have?
The all-aluminum 3.3-liter GDI V-6 makes 290 horsepower and 252 pound-feet of torque. A 191-hp, 2.4-liter GDI four-cylinder engine is standard, but likely to be rare–and rightly so, since the V-6 almost matches it on gas mileage, and far outpoints it in pure power.

What’s the price of a 2014 Kia Sorento?
The price of a used 2014 Kia Sorento ranges from about $15,250 for the base trim with front-wheel drive and a four-cylinder engine to about $24,000 for the fully loaded four-wheel-drive SX Limited trim with a V6 engine.
The 2014 Kia Sorento has a 191-horsepower four-cylinder engine, which is fine for daily driving around town. The available 290-horsepower V6 performs better on the highway. The Sorento’s base engine provides up to 20 mpg in the city and 26 mpg on the highway.

What are the safety features on a Kia Sorento?
Standard safety features for all 2014 Kia Sorento models include antilock disc brakes, stability and traction control, hill-start assist, front-seat side airbags, side curtain airbags for the first two rows and active front headrests. A rearview camera and rear parking sensors are standard on all EX and SX models and optional on the LX.
